Summary

MySignature’s 2023 survey of more than 250 participants, supplemented by data from 20,000 user accounts across countries including the United States, United Kingdom, Germany, Spain, and India, examines how professionals and businesses use email signatures. Most respondents, 89.9%, use one signature, while 8.6% use up to 10, and 44.4% update their signatures two to four times annually, compared with 31.6% who update them only once every few years. Users commonly check email frequently, with 77.8% doing so more than five times daily, and typically send 11 to 25 business emails per day. Marketing and sales, real estate and construction, agencies and consulting, and e-commerce are identified as prominent sectors using signatures, primarily to strengthen branding and awareness and to standardize employee communications across companies. The findings also report that 36.3% do not use email trackers, while 25.1% use paid trackers and 14.1% use free options.
